Output 62de44b6ca22987330552ab81abdcb934f2fb96cac287eca33ad4c88a085c17a:20

value
3684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c57e8de1e915c9ac85f58509f4aaa54a7b65fbaea1e9f0cdf8e9994480c89969
address
bc1pc4lgmc0fzhy6ep04s5ylf249ffakt7aw585lpn0caxv5fqxgn95sawdwq8
transaction
62de44b6ca22987330552ab81abdcb934f2fb96cac287eca33ad4c88a085c17a
spent
true